Wine fluency is critical for a wide variety of professionals and represents an important area of executive refinement. This is not simply an interesting culinary topic. Knowing the essentials is a matter of critical business etiquette. Failing to have such knowledge can also leave you vulnerable to certain etiquette mistakes in various professional contexts.
The good news is that the learning experience can be easy and fun, and there is no need to descend into wine snobbery along the way. Use this book and the FREE VIDEO SUPPLEMENTS to ensure you know the essentials.
THE ESSENTIALS:
-Facts you should know about certain wine regions
-Key characteristics of various grapes and wines
-How to confidently pair wine with food
-Discussion of iconic wines that you should recognize
-Review of wine etiquette essentials

R. Sean Cochran is the founder of Executive Wine Education (www.executivewineeducation.com), a group specialized in coaching for executives seeking to achieve a higher level of wine fluency. Sean is a also a Managing Director and sales division leader in a global financial institution. He has served as a sales, advisory, and business coach to many of the world's top investment professionals in North America, Asia, and Australia. Sean holds an MBA in Finance and Economics from Columbia Business School and a BA in Philosophy from Arizona State University. He is also a Certified Financial Planner (CFP®) and a Certified Specialist of Wine (CSW) with the Society of Wine Educators. Sean currently resides in Sydney, Australia with his wife Angela and daughters, Madison and Olivia.
